In case of a collision or an impact with a floating object, stop to examine the hull, the buoyancy
tubes, the motor and its attachments and return to shore at a low speed.
Signal for help.
Following an accident and before using the craft again, make sure that it is examined by
your dealer or a qualified technician and any defects are repaired.
NEGLECTING REGULAR INSPECTIONS AND REPAIRS MAY LEAD TO A SERIOUS INJURY
OR DAMAGE AND WILL REDUCE THE LIFE OF YOUR BOAT.
